ONLINE ENROLLMENT OPENS APRIL 22ND FOR ROSEBURG SCHOOL DISTRICT

April 18, 2024 3:30 a.m.  

Online enrollment for the Roseburg School District will open Monday April 22nd for the 2024-25 school year.

A district release said all new, returning, and re-enrolling students will be required to enroll online to begin the registration process.

Assistant Superintendent Michelle Knee said families can access a comprehensive guide to the online registration process, including necessary documents and parent portal links, at the district’s website: https://www.roseburg.k12.or.us/families/enrollmentandregistration/onlineenrollmentandregistration. Knee said this initial step is important for students of all grades, leading to final in-person registration in the fall.
